The general issue with this measure of mortality (dead/(infected + dead)) is that you're assuming that the infected won't die. In a disease that is exponentially growing, a better approximation of evaluating your survival chances is to look at the death to recovery rate (dead / (recovered + dead)). Based on the available data [1], we are closer to 7.8% than 2% mortality, which is closer to the final mortality rate of…

I don't understand your first argument. Surely increasing the denominator would lower the mortality percent? Also does the total number of infected not include the dead?

But the infected who isn’t dead may or may not die at the end. So using infected as the denominator is not accurate. But using just the recovered as denim Arie is also incorrect unless you have enough samples. Using China’s figures are wildly inaccurate because of lack of tests and transparency. So maybe a better complex model can be derived from current datas

There seems to be many cases of young patients dying in Iran. Either because there are way more cases than being officially reported or (hopefully not) the virus has mutated to affect the young more, or both. The first hypothesis is likely based on the number of infections found in international travellers who went to Iran. We still cannot rule out the second hypothesis though. A 23-year-old woman soccer player: http…

Dr. Li Wenliang, who warned of Covid early on, was also only 34 years old.

Doctors and nurses are exposed to a much higher viral load than most people. In Wuhan, they may also overwork and have insufficient sleep.
